#6606b2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#6606b2 is composed of 40% red, 2.4% green and 69.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 42.7% cyan, 96.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 30.2% black. It has a hue angle of 273.5 degrees, a saturation of 93.5% and a lightness of 36.1%. #6606b2 color hex could be obtained by blending #cc0cff with #000065. Closest websafe color is: #660099.

#6606b2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#6606b2 has RGB values of R:102, G:6, B:178 and CMYK values of C:0.43, M:0.97, Y:0, K:0.3. Its decimal value is 6686386.

Shades and Tints of #6606b2
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040007 is the darkest color, while #faf3ff is the lightest one.
